正文
手写组件架构设计,手写组件架构设计图
小程序:扫一扫查出行
【扫一扫了解最新限行尾号】
复制小程序
【扫一扫了解最新限行尾号】
复制小程序
在系统设计中怎样写系统体系结构的设计?
(1)地下水系统三维可视化软件运行的基础是地下水资源数据库系统,系统运行的所有原始数据均来源于地下水资源数据库,二者之间需要实现紧密的有机结合。(2)地下水系统三维可视化软件运行的核心数据是地下水系统的三维结构数据,它以数据库的形式存储。本系统的各个子系统均是围绕该数据库进行操作。
分 简单来说,就是:画图,全方位的剖析系统,设计类。其中要画出用例图,状态图,时序图,类图。下面就我做过的一个“大富翁”游戏的体系结构设计为例。 用例图: 时序图: 类图: 把用户对系统的需求划分成系统的一个个功能模块并设计好类,就可以进行开发了。
方法/步骤一个软件项目在需求确定后,就可以开始系统的架构设计了。架构设计不同于编写代码,需要遵循严格的语法和编程规范。它没有规范可遵循,存在即合理,适合系统开发和运行的架构就是最合理的系统架构。
设计需求 地质灾害系统自组织体系 地质灾害系统作为一个开放的自组织体系,在内外界持续干扰的作用下,该体系形成涨落,从而体系状态发生质变,形成一种更加稳定有序的结构。地质灾害系统是由孕灾环境、致灾因子与承灾体共同组成的地球表层变异系统。灾情则是这一体系涨落作用的产物。
架构设计的4+1视图:场景视图、逻辑视图、物理视图、流程视图和开发视图...
1、首先,场景视图是架构的起点,它通过用例图揭示系统的用户行为和交互,展示系统的核心需求。通过设计用例,我们可以定义角色(Actor)、系统边界和功能场景,确保系统的功能满足用户期待,其他视图的构建都以这一基础为依托。逻辑视图,犹如软件的骨架,用UML的组件图和类图描绘组件间的功能关系和约束。
2、场景视图 :静态方面用 用例图 表现,动态方面用活动图、状态图、交互图表现。逻辑视图:包含了类、接口、协作,静态方面用 类图和对象图表现,动态方面用活动图、状态图、交互图表现。开发视图:(Development View),描述了在开发环境中软件的静态组织结构。静态方面用 组件图 表示。
3、UML 的“4+1视图”是指从某个角度观察系统构成的 4+1个视图,每个视图都是系统描述的一个投影,说明了系统某个侧面的特征。
4、由此,4个视图就分别是逻辑视图,开发视图,进程视图和物理视图。另外“+1”的视图是选择一些用例和场景来描述架构。开发视图:开发视图是从程序员,以及软件管理的角度来描述系统。这个视图也被称为实现视图,往往使用UML组件图来描述系统构成。逻辑视图:逻辑视图主要描述系统为最终用户提供的功能。
5、+1 视图包括:逻辑视图( Logic View ),开发视图( Develop View ),进程视图( Process View ),物理视图( Physical View )和场景视图( Scenarios )。视图间的关系4+1 视图不仅便于我们记录架构设计,实际上它也指导了我们进行架构设计活动的部分过程。
6、逻辑视图 开发视图 过程视图 物理视图 场景视图 4+1视图提出后,业界也有其它的观点提出,诸如SEI(模块视图、组建和连接件视图、分配视图)、西门子4种视图(概念、模块、代码、执行视图)、以及RM-ODP(企业视图、信息视图、计算视图、工程师图)等。
如何做好架构设计与写好架构设计的文档?
活动图则如业务流程的剧本,引入泳道概念,清晰展示过程逻辑。从概念到文档:设计阶段的深化 在软件设计的各个阶段,架构师需精心选择和使用模型。
用MECE架构清晰的主题层级 主题层级相互独立,完全穷尽。在关键的主题层级上,要尽量追求不重复、不遗漏。其中,MECE指的是: 各部分之间相互独立(Mutually Exclusive);所有部分完全穷尽(Collectively Exhaustive)。 结论的语句要放在段首或者文档开头 结论先行。
软件架构,如同建筑的灵魂,是大型系统设计的抽象蓝图,它揭示了系统的结构和运作方式。让我们深入探讨它的几个关键组成部分,以便更好地理解如何进行有效的设计。业务架构,是设计的起点,它将模糊的商业愿景转化为清晰的流程和问题领域。这个阶段,我们的目标是将业务逻辑条理化,以便于理解和实现。
word文档怎么制作组织架构图 你好 仔细看看 好好学学 第我们首先执行“插入”——“图片”——“组织结构图”,然后先在文件中插入一个基本结构图,展开“组织结构图”工具条。第然后我们可以选中下面其中的一个框图,按下Del键,而把多余的一个框图删除。
系统架构设计师知识点总结:软件架构风格
1、总结来说,架构师的蓝图是一门艺术与科学的融合,通过理解和掌握各种风格与模式,我们可以构建出健壮、灵活且可扩展的软件架构。这些原则和方法犹如设计师的调色盘,赋予软件设计无限可能性。
2、架构风格是描述某一特定应用领域中系统组织方式的惯用模式,是系统主要的、组织性的设计。风格是模式的外在表现。三者的共同点是都用于设计,是一套可重用的方法套路。
3、理软件产品的高级设计。软件架构师定义和设计软件的模块化,模块之间的交互,用户界面风格,对外接口方法,创新的设计特性,以及高层事物的对象操作、逻辑 和流程。一般而言,软件系统的架构(Architecture)有两个要素:它是一个软件系统从整体到部分的最高层次的划分。
4、软件架构设计的原则 软件架构设计必须遵循以下原则: 满足功能性需求和非功能需求。这是一个软件系统最基本的要求,也是架构设计时应该遵循的最基本的原则。 实用性原则,就像每一个软件系统交付给用户使用时必须实用,能解决用户的问题一样,架构设计也必须实用,否则就会“高来高去”或“过度设计”。
手写组件架构设计的介绍就聊到这里吧,感谢你花时间阅读本站内容,更多关于手写组件架构设计图、手写组件架构设计的信息别忘了在本站进行查找喔。